Abbreviated CV

I graduated with a Bachelor in Chemical Engineering (UPV/EHU, 2005). That same year, I entered the CPWV research group with an FPU (University Professor Program) scholarship to undertake a PhD. I took part in a research exchange with the University of Western Ontario (Canada) in 2008. Upon my return, I started my teaching career as an internal teacher in the Faculty of Science and Technology (FCT/ZTF).

After defending my thesis in 2010, I taught at the Technical Engineering School of Bilbao (2010) and the Superior School of Engineering of Bilbao (2010-2012). In 2012, I obtained a position as Assistant Professor in the Chemical Engineering Department at the UPV/EHU. I have been an Associate Professor in the same department since 2020.

My research activity focuses on the following topics: i) valorization of wastes (plastics, tires, biomass, etc.) or secondary refinery streams via pyrolysis and catalytic cracking so as to obtain fuels or recover monomers; ii) sustainable production of hydrogen via reforming of oxygenate compounds such as ethanol and bio-oil; as well as in situ CO2 capture; iii) design, testing, and kinetic modelling of reactors that are suitable for these processes, such as: the conical spouted bed, fluidized beds, or the FCC riser simulator, as well as the analysis of reaction mechanisms by means of operando reactors (FTIR and UV-Vis spectroscopic cells) and their correlation to conventional reactors; and iv) synthesis, characterization, selection of catalysts, and their optimization, with special emphasis on their deactivation and regenerability.

My current research activity focuses on the valorization of wastes via pyrolysis in order to obtain value added products, as well as on the analysis of catalyst deactivation. I have taken part as a researcher in 31 Research Programs, which have given way to 33 articles in indexed journals (JCR). These articles have been cited on more than 3200 occasions, having an h-index of 24. I have also taken part in more than 80 contributions to conferences, mostly international, where I have been awarded the best contribution to the conference three times.

I am currently a member of the research commission of the FCT/ZTF, and the third year coordinator for the Biotechnology Bachelor program and the subjects Mass Transfer and Fluid Mechanics. I teach three subjects in English in the Biotechnology and Chemical Engineering Bachelor programs, in addition to a subject from the Master’s Degree in Chemical Engineering (Modelling and Simulation of Chemical Processes).
